High-Density Optical Networking for AI Data Centers

Built on silicon photonics, iPronics ONE is an optical circuit switching (OCS) platform that provides programmable optical connectivity within and across racks. It enables AI clusters to scale with greater bandwidth, lower latency, reduced power consumption, and simpler infrastructure.

AI Compute at Scale Starts with the Network.

AI Cluster Networks Are Reaching Architectural Limits

AI workloads are becoming larger and more communication-intensive as AI clusters continue to grow. Traditional copper network architectures are becoming harder to scale efficiently, increasing network complexity, power consumption, and infrastructure costs while accelerating the shift to optical connectivity.

Built for AI Workloads

Reconfigurable optical connectivity helps AI clusters make better use of GPUs across training, inference, and workload continuity.

High-Throughput Training

High-bandwidth optical connectivity for large-scale training across GPU domains.

Inference

Low-latency optical connectivity for demanding inference workloads across AI clusters.

GPU Failover for Workload Continuity

Redirect connectivity to an available GPU to maintain workload continuity.
